The Cycle-3 Call for Proposals was released
on 1 Nov 05! The deadline was 16 Feb 06, at 1pm (1300h) Pacific time.
On behalf of the Spitzer Project and NASA, the Spitzer Science Center
(SSC) at Caltech has issued the Cycle-3 Call for Proposals (CP),
soliciting research proposals for the General Observer (GO), Archival
Research (AR), and Theoretical Research (TR) programs.
